Jing Yan is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Mechanics of Materials and Metals and Alloys. According to data from OpenAlex, Jing Yan has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 537 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Materials Chemistry, 20 papers in Mechanics of Materials and 12 papers in Metals and Alloys. Recurrent topics in Jing Yan's work include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(21 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(19 papers) and Hydrogen embrittlement and corrosion behaviors in metals (12 papers). Jing Yan is often cited by papers focused on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(21 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(19 papers) and Hydrogen embrittlement and corrosion behaviors in metals (12 papers). Jing Yan coll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Jing Yan's co-authors include Hongyuan Fan, Jun Wang, Yuanhua Lin, Lan Sun, Jun Wang, Jun Wang, Qiang Zhang, Dezhi Zeng, Jun Wang and Mingbo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Langmuir and Scientific Reports.
